How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ellwood City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ellwood City Studio Apartments | $1,284 | $660 | $1,729 |
| Ellwood City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,617 | $750 | $2,767 |
| Ellwood City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,769 | $772 | $2,484 |
| Ellwood City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,061 | $732 | $3,374 |
| Ellwood City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,702 | $792 | $2,295 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Ellwood City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Ellwood City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Ellwood City is $1,769.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Ellwood City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Ellwood City is a 1,900 square feet unit starting from $1,800 at Pineloch Estates Apartments.
What is the average size for Ellwood City 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Ellwood City is currently 1,247 sq ft.
